30 Years of Legacy, Compassion & Service
Thirty years ago, the Peoria Fire-Medical Department lost one of its own to cancer—Johnny Valentine.
In the days that followed, the fire family came together to support Johnny’s family during an incredibly difficult time. As the years passed, Johnny’s family found their footing again and made a selfless request: use the remaining funds to help children in need.
That simple act of compassion became the beginning of something much bigger.
In August 1996, the seeds of what would become Peoria Firefighters Charities were planted. In 2000, the organization was officially established.
Today, 30 years later, we have come a long way. Thousands of lives have been touched, countless families and children have received help, and the generosity of the Peoria Fire-Medical family and our community continues to make a difference.
But through all of that growth, one thing has never changed—the legacy of Johnny Valentine and what he represented.
